MSSQL数据库如何快速从TXT文件导入数据(mssql导入txt文件)

摘要:本文旨在介绍如何快速使用MSSQL数据库从TXT文件导入数据。首先介绍TXT文件的插入方式,然后介绍通过ODBC文件连接和“文本源”连接器将TXT文件中的数据导入MSSQL数据库的方法,最后介绍如何使用Transact-SQL进行导入。

MSSQL数据库是一种复杂的关系型数据库,为了有效地分析和操作数据,通常需要将TXT文件中的数据导入MSSQL数据库。本文详细介绍MSSQL数据库如何快速从TXT文件导入数据。

一种快速将TXT文件数据导入MSSQL数据库的方法是使用“文本源”连接器,在MSSQL管理工具中打开查询设计器,随后使用“文本源”连接器将TXT文件作为数据源连接到本地MSSQL数据库,即可将TXT文件中的数据导入MSSQL数据库,如下所示:

select * from OPENROWSET (‘MSDASQL’,’Driver=Microsoft Text Driver (*.txt; *.csv);DefaultDir=C:\data’,’select * from input.txt’)

另一种快速将TXT文件中的数据导入MSSQL数据库的方法是使用ODBC文件连接,在MSSQL管理工具中打开查询设计器,随后使用ODBC文件连接器将TXT文件作为数据源连接到本地MSSQL数据库,即可将TXT文件中的数据导入MSSQL数据库,如下所示:

select * from OPENROWSET (‘MSDASQL’,’Driver={Microsoft Text Driver (*.txt; *.csv)};DBQ=C:\Data’,’select * from input.txt’)

最后介绍如何使用Transact-SQL将TXT文件中的数据导入MSSQL数据库,将cleardata.txt文件中的数据导入到myTable表中,可以使用以下代码:

BULK INSERT myTable

FROM ‘C:\Data\cleardata.txt’

WITH

(

FIELDTERMINATOR = ‘,’,

ROWTERMINATOR = ‘\n’

)

综上所述,本文介绍了如何使用MSSQL数据库从TXT文件中快速导入数据的三种方法,即使用“文本源”连接器、ODBC文件连接器和Transact-SQL。理解和使用这些方法可以帮助用户快速将TXT文件中的数据导入MSSQL数据库,从而更好地保护和维护数据。


数据运维技术 » MSSQL数据库如何快速从TXT文件导入数据(mssql导入txt文件)